When choosing a high visibility vest, it is important to consider the type of work you will be doing and the specific hazards you may encounter. There are different classes of high vis vests, each designed for a specific level of visibility and protection. For example, Class 1 vests are suitable for low-risk environments, while Class 3 vests are recommended for high-risk settings such as construction sites or busy roadways.

It is also essential to ensure that your high visibility vest meets industry standards for visibility and reflectivity. Look for vests that comply with ANSI/ISEA standards, which specify the minimum requirements for high vis apparel to ensure optimal safety and visibility. These standards cover factors such as the color of the vest, the amount of reflective material used, and the placement of the reflective stripes for maximum visibility.

In addition to meeting safety standards, it is important to properly maintain your high vis vest to ensure its effectiveness. Regularly inspect the vest for any signs of wear or damage, such as fading colors or torn fabric, and replace it as needed. It is also important to keep the vest clean and free of dirt or debris that can diminish its visibility.
